Introduction
Reketo tablet is a nutrient supplement with an active ingredient called Alpha Ketoanalogue. It belongs to the class of medicine called amino acids. It is given along with a protein-restricted diet to delay the progression of chronic kidney disease (CKD). It reduces uraemic symptoms (caused by the accumulation of nitrogenous waste compounds normally eliminated by the kidneys), improves nutritional status, and reduces metabolic complications in CKD patients. Reketo tablet nitrogen urea reduction levels in the bloodstream and slowing down the advancement of kidney disease, thereby delaying the need for long-term dialysis.
Do not consume Reketo tablet if you are allergic to Alpha Ketoanalogue or any of its ingredients. Avoid consuming this medicine if you have hypercalcemia (high level of calcium) or abnormal heartbeats; because the administration of this medicine may cause increased calcium levels in the blood and irregular heartbeats. During treatment, your doctor may recommend periodic monitoring of your serum calcium levels. Notifying your doctor if you are pregnant and breastfeeding before taking this medicine. Uses
Treatment of Chronic kidney disease
Delaying disease progression and the onset of dialysis
Reducing metabolic complications due to renal insufficiency
Reduction of uraemic symptoms
How Reketo Tablet Works
Reketo tablet is classified as a nutritional supplement that operates through comparable catabolic pathways to amino acids. Enhanced protein metabolism promotes improved renal function, thereby delaying the progression of chronic kidney disease. Additionally, it ensures the intake of essential amino acids.

Side Effects
Reketo tablet side effects are unwanted symptoms caused by medicines. Even though all medicines cause side effects, not everyone gets them.
Common
- Increased calcium level in the blood

FAQs about Reketo Tablet
Q1.
How to manage the side effects of the Reketo tablet?
To manage the side effects of the Reketo tablet, follow the prescribed dosage, and report side effects promptly. Stay hydrated, and monitor your calcium level regularly. Maintain a healthy lifestyle, and attend follow-up appointments.
Q2.
What is a Reketo tablet?
Alpha ketoanalogue Reketo tablets are nutritional supplements containing essential amino acids and keto analogues. They improve protein metabolism and support renal function in patients with chronic kidney disease. They are prescribed to manage and delay the progression of kidney disease.
Q3.
Can you take Reketo tablet when pregnant?
Consult your medical professional regarding the use of Reketo tablet during pregnancy. The potential benefits and risks should be carefully assessed. Your doctor will suggest taking this medicine only if it's necessary.
Q4.
What are the side effects of Reketo tablet?
A common side effect of Reketo tablet is increased calcium levels in the blood. It is crucial to consult your doctor for any concerns or persistent side effects.
Q5.
What should I do if I miss a dose of Reketo tablet?
If you miss a capsule dose, take it as soon as possible. However, if it's close to the time for your next dose, skip the missed dose and continue with your regular schedule. Do not double the dose of the Reketo tablet.
